Huguette Clark’s Last Apartment Now Up For Sale

Huguette ClarkAs I have previously discussed, the Fifth Avenue apartments that belonged to Huguette Clark were on the market for sale. Now, it appears that the last apartment that she owned is about to be sold for $7.2 Million. This last apartment, which went on sale on April 5, is apparently the one that housed doll collection. Clerk began her collection in the 1960s following the death of her mother. Her apartment was filled with her dolls. The apartment itself is in an amazing collection because it over looks central park.

Even though the estate has placed the apartments on the market, “the co-op board of has been highly particular about who they want in the building – barring Qatari Prime Minister Sheikh Hamad bin Jassim bin Jaber Al Thani, who wanted to buy the entire eight floor last year.” The co-op board did allow Frederick Iseman to purchase one of the eight floor apartments. In the apartment’s entirety, the building is worth about $12 Million. 

See Katie Davis, Last Trace of Reclusive Millionaire Heiress Leaves New York’s Fifth Avenue: Her Final Apartment – That Was Home To Just Her Dolls – Goes On Sale For $7.2 Million, The Daily Mail, Apr. 12, 2013.
